Major Grocery Chains in West Kelowna:
West Kelowna, like most growing communities, is well-served by major grocery chains. These stores generally offer a wide selection of products at competitive prices, making them a popular choice for many residents.
-
Superstore (Loblaws): A prominent player in the Canadian grocery scene, Superstore offers a vast selection of groceries, household items, and even clothing. Known for its President's Choice brand, which offers a range of quality products at competitive prices, Superstore often features weekly flyers with deals and discounts. Expect a large store layout, potentially leading to longer shopping trips, but the wide array of choices compensates for this. Their in-store bakery, deli, and meat counter add to the overall shopping experience. Location considerations are crucial; choosing the closest Superstore to your home can significantly reduce travel time.
-
Save-On-Foods: Another major Canadian chain, Save-On-Foods is known for its commitment to fresh, locally-sourced produce. They often partner with local farmers and producers, providing customers with a greater selection of seasonal fruits and vegetables. Save-On-Foods also generally has a robust loyalty program, offering discounts and personalized deals based on your shopping history. Their store layout is typically user-friendly, though size can still be a factor depending on the specific location. Like Superstore, consider the location's proximity to your home.
-
Safeway: A long-standing grocery store chain in Western Canada, Safeway provides a reliable option with a consistent selection of products. While perhaps not as expansive as Superstore in terms of overall product variety, Safeway maintains a solid range of groceries, household items, and a convenient in-store pharmacy in some locations. They often feature competitive pricing, particularly on their own branded products, and participate in various loyalty programs. The store atmosphere is typically clean and organized, making for a pleasant shopping experience.

Factors to Consider When Choosing Your Grocery Store:
Choosing the right grocery store involves considering several key factors:
-
Price: Price is a primary concern for most shoppers. Larger chain stores generally offer competitive prices, especially when utilizing their loyalty programs and weekly flyers. Smaller, specialized stores often have higher prices, reflecting the premium quality and specialized nature of their products.
-
Location & Convenience: Proximity to your home is a crucial factor. A closer store, even if slightly more expensive, can save valuable time and fuel costs. Consider the store's parking availability and ease of access, especially if you have mobility limitations or shop with young children.
-
Product Selection: Consider your dietary needs and preferences. If you're a vegetarian, vegan, or follow a specific diet, choose a store with a wide selection of suitable products. If you prefer organic or locally-sourced food, prioritize stores specializing in these options.
-
Store Atmosphere & Customer Service: A pleasant shopping environment can significantly improve the overall experience. Consider factors like store cleanliness, organization, and the helpfulness of the staff. A friendly and helpful staff can make a big difference, particularly if you have questions about products or need assistance.
-
Loyalty Programs & Discounts: Many grocery stores offer loyalty programs, providing discounts, rewards points, and personalized offers. Consider the benefits and drawbacks of different programs, choosing one that aligns with your shopping habits and preferences.
-
Delivery & Online Ordering: The convenience of online grocery shopping and delivery is increasingly important. Check if your preferred store offers these options, as it can save time and effort, particularly for busy individuals or those with limited mobility.
